This is the latest Chelsea team news for their Premier League clash with Wolverhampton Wanderers. This will include the most recent comments from manager Liam Rosenior from Thursday’s press conference, before offering a predicted lineup based on recent lineups and availability concerns. This is an easy win on paper against last-placed Wolves but their form since the turn of the year has been far better, meaning they have got at least a few points on the board for once.
Rob Sanchez has started in goal as the first-choice option. The back line has seen Malo Gusto, Wes Fofana, Jorrel Hato, Marc Cucurella, Trevoh Chalobah, Reece James, Josh Acheampong, and Trevoh Chalobah feature as either a four or a five depending on the system.
Andrey Santos and Moises Caicedo has emerged as the preferred pivot in midfield with Enzo Fernandez capable of filling in as the third option. Enzo has been moved to the number ten spot with Estevao, Jamie Gittens, Pedro Neto, and Alejandro Garnacho starting on the wings. Cole Palmer has been in and out of the squad but can play either in that number ten spot or out wide.
Joao Pedro is the in-form striker option but has shared the role with Liam Delap despite the former Ipswich man having just one league goal to date.
The team primarily uses a 4-2-3-1 but have also switched to a 3-4-2-1/3-5-2 system in some matches when their opposition calls for it. The relationship between full back and winger are more standard with overlaps and underlaps offered to avoid 1 v 1s against heavily defensive sides. The team still builds up from the back with the pivot staying closer together to offer options with the goalkeeper playing high and adding another body when trying to bypass the opposition press.
Since making a managerial change, the Blues are on fine form, the two losses to Arsenal are the only blips but the other wins showed a solid ability to outscore their opponents and carve out results when needed. The lack of clean sheets will continue to worry fans and the manager but the current attacking output shuold be enough to get the team over the line and into European football.
According to PremierInjuries, there could be as many as nine different absentees in this one. The manager has inherited a slight injury crisis with minor injuries piling up on top of the long-term absentees. For this one he could be without Levi Colwill, Dario Essugo, Romeo Lavia, Gittens, Filip Jorgensen, James, Neto, Tosin Adarabioyo, and Mykhailo Mudryk.
Fofana appears to be getting managed through this season following injury so he could be rested here, the same goes for Joao Pedro who worked quite hard at the weekend and could be left to the substitutes’ bench this time out.
